J B & S Lees
JB&S Lees are manufacturers of cold rolled strip in mild, carbon and alloy steel grades, pinpoint carbide strip and bi-metal strip for metal saws.
In addition to a full range of precision cold rolled strip in mild, carbon and alloy grades from 0.20mm (0.0079 in) to 3.00mm (0.1181in) thick, JB and S Lees produce hardened and tempered strip for narrow bandsaws, a unique pinpoint carbide steel strip for metal cutting bandsaws and a bi-metal strip for composite saw blades.
Development of materials to meet specific customer needs is an essential element of the Lees service and a modern fully equipped laboratory supports this facility.
Continuous investment has ensured that Lees utilises the latest production plant available for the manufacture of precision strip products. Lees has a well established position in major export markets around the world, and JB and S Lees Inc. was established over 25 years ago with offices and warehousing facilities in Fairfield, New Jersey to service the important North American market.
Firth Cleveland Steel Strip
Firth Cleveland manufactured of a wide range of specialist hardened and tempered spring steel strip used for the production of hand tools, precision blades and springs. The business produces a wide range of strip steels in medium carbon, high carbon and low alloy grades.
There is no such thing as a standard product at Firth Cleveland and the company’s flexibility gives it the ability to manufacture strip products to customers’ individual requirements.
Firth Cleveland Steel Strip offers a range of surface finishes and colours and can provide strip with dressed or ground edges for particular applications.
Firth Cleveland strip is used by leading manufacturers of hand tools, precision blades and springs in over 50 countries worldwide.
Sales in North America, Mexico and Brazil are serviced by a USA subsidiary, Firth Cleveland Steels Inc, from its offices and warehousing facilities in Fairfield, New Jersey.
